Frequently Asked Questions about the 98141 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 98141?

There are currently 1,378 Studio Apartments in 98141 with rent ranges from $610 to $4,130 with an average price of $1,764.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 98141 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 98141 ranges from $625 to $7,910 with an average monthly rent of $2,551.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 98141 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 98141 range from $950 to $26,058.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,953.

How expensive are 98141 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 212 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 98141 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,175 to $31,995 - averaging $7,401 for the location.
